Liberación cortical focal de opioides endógenos durante las convulsiones inducidas por la lectura
M J Koepp1, M P Richardson, D J Brooks
1MRC Cyclotron Unit Hammersmith Hospital, London, UK.
Lancet (London, England)
|September 30, 1998
Resumen
Los péptidos opioides ayudan a detener las convulsiones. En la epilepsia inducida por la lectura, la unión del receptor opioide inferior en el cerebro sugiere que estas sustancias son clave para la terminación de las convulsiones.

Sus antecedentes:
- Los estudios en animales sugieren que los péptidos opioides endógenos terminan con las convulsiones.
- Investigando la neurotransmisión opioide en las convulsiones inducidas por la lectura y la función cognitiva.
Objetivo del estudio:
- Para localizar cambios en la neurotransmisión opioide durante las convulsiones parciales.
- Para comparar la liberación de opiáceos en pacientes con epilepsia de lectura frente a controles sanos.
Principales métodos:
- Se utilizaron escáneres de tomografía por emisión de positrones (PET) con 11C-diprenorfina (DPN).
- Se escanearon 5 pacientes con epilepsia de lectura y 6 controles durante las tareas de referencia y activación.
- Se empleó cartografía paramétrica estadística para analizar las diferencias de unión al receptor de opioides.
Principales resultados:
- Se reduce significativamente la unión 11C-DPN en la corteza parieto-temporo-occipital izquierda (área de Brodmann 37) en pacientes con epilepsia por lectura.
- Diferencias observadas durante las exploraciones de activación (lectura de un artículo científico).
Conclusiones:
- Las sustancias similares a los opioides parecen desempeñar un papel en la terminación de las convulsiones inducidas por la lectura.
- Los hallazgos apoyan la participación de los opioides endógenos en los mecanismos de control de las convulsiones.

Epilepsy and Seizures: Overview
Epilepsy is a chronic neurological disease marked by recurrent, unpredictable seizures. These seizures are caused by abnormal electrical discharges in the brain, leading to behavior, sensation, or consciousness alterations. They can also cause transient impairment of awareness, interfering with daily activities.
Various factors can trigger epilepsy, including genetic factors, brain damage, metabolic causes, and unknown etiology. Diagnosis of epilepsy involves electroencephalography (EEG), which...
